Web Publishing shows only 5 records?

Featured Replies

Hi, I have one problem,

I use Web Publishing with one of my data bases, and when I create a layout as a LIST, in web browser it shows only 5 records at time ( per page), why is that? I would like it to show the whole page. In table layout it shows all records, but that is not what I want.(table layout I mean)

This is a FAQ, use a cartesian product selfjoin portal, but for the sake of userfriendlyness chop it up in smaller chunks, to avoid hogging connectionspeed. This is usually done by cutting the gathered ID's via ValuelistItems( making a primary key into renderingjobs of less than 50 records per view, in say a tabbed view or fiddling with a global field controling the primary key.

Alright you should think of why this limitation have been introduced, it is there to make the webpage render as quick as posible ...so if more lines should be shown, must a selfjoin relation be introduced. The cartesian type makes you show all records via a portal. But even if a scroll bar is put on the portal, is it a tough task to render say 40000 records this way.

We, in the company I work for only use form views, where we then usher in only chunks of max 50 records into portals by using multilinekeys for the portals relation, because we do not have any desires in annoying users away from the interfaces.

Another option is to run the available updaters for FM7 Web Publishing Engine. The last versions of v7 and all versions of 8 and 8.5 show 25 records per page in list view and 50 in table view. If this is enough for you, then you don't have to use a portal..
